To understand where the 1 million threshold sits, it is essential to look at the data from reputable financial institutions and the Federal Reserve. According to the Federal Reserve's Survey of Consumer Finances, which is considered the gold standard for US wealth statistics, the most recent comprehensive data from 2022 provides the clearest snapshot. In that year, the survey indicated that approximately 7% of households in the United States had a net worth of $1 million or more. This figure excludes the value of primary residences, meaning these are households whose investments, retirement accounts, and other assets minus debts exceed the million-dollar mark. When you factor in primary residences, the percentage of households with a total net worth exceeding $1 million rises to roughly 10% to 12%, as the value of real estate significantly boosts the total numbers for middle-class families in expensive housing markets.
